Output 6827c6ca10d7fbb673b9630f18fc12d89c340ddef770ae132788863614dee3ea:0

value
42500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b74dee6422ae290fc4763a9e60a6d9feffeaf8f OP_EQUAL
address
MQzLbcymCGizq6YqkCDAhfpnBnP2a3ULf6
transaction
6827c6ca10d7fbb673b9630f18fc12d89c340ddef770ae132788863614dee3ea
spent
true